Obviously I have no right to demand folks stay on topic. However, I would appreciate it if you guys did just that.

So please....here is the topic in a nutshell.....

Bioware continues to have communication issues. They chose to keep most information about the level sync system close to the chest, and in that information vacuum speculation ran wild.

Now, right now, folks are spreading fallacies across the net about the system, and because there is little to no information to refute it it has gained momentum.

I believe this was an error....level sync is a SUBSTANTIAL change to the game, so substantial IMO that it should have had an open discussion ACROSS THE NET, not just here. In fact, they should have done some press on it, perhaps a few interviews....tell people a few important things before it was released, like......

1) The level sync drops you to a level that is max for the planet, right at the border of when mobs would normally become grey. You are usually 2 to 5 levels above all enemy mobs.

2) You keep all of your special abilities despite the fact you are reduced in level.

3) Companions have received a HUGE strength boost to help compensate for the level sync system. (this is speculative of course, this may not be the reason)


If they adjusted aggro range, IMO, it would be perfect. That is just my view, I realize folks have other issues with it, but that is my take.

Had they communicated this in the market, on websites and the like the current diatribe against level sync outside the game and this forum could have been avoided IMO.
